The Significance of Motorcycle Value

Before we dive into the details of NADA motorcycle values, let’s understand why knowing the value of a motorcycle is important:

1. Informed Buying:

If you’re considering purchasing a used motorcycle, understanding its value helps you make an informed decision. It ensures that you’re not overpaying for the motorcycle and helps you negotiate a fair deal.

2. Competitive Selling:

When selling your motorcycle, pricing it competitively based on its value is crucial. This approach attracts potential buyers and increases the likelihood of a successful sale.

3. Trade-Ins and Financing:

If you’re looking to trade in your motorcycle for an upgrade or seeking financing for a new ride, knowing the value of your current motorcycle is beneficial. It aids in negotiations and can help you secure favorable terms.

How Is NADA Motorcycle Value Determined?

Get Cars Value methodology for determining motorcycle values is meticulous and data-driven. It involves:

Make and Model:

The year, make, and model of the motorcycle play a crucial role in its valuation. Popular and well-regarded brands and models tend to retain their value better.

Mileage:

The number of miles a motorcycle has traveled is a significant consideration. Lower mileage typically leads to a higher value, as it suggests less wear and tear.

Optional Features:

Any additional features, upgrades, or accessories can significantly impact a motorcycle’s value. Features like upgraded exhaust systems, custom paint jobs, and premium tires can increase its worth.

Condition:

The overall condition of the motorcycle, including both mechanical and cosmetic aspects, plays a pivotal role in determining its value. Well-maintained motorcycles are valued higher.

NADA Motorcycle Value for Informed Transactions

Buying a Used Motorcycle:

When buying a used motorcycle, follow these steps to make an informed purchase:

Research the Motorcycle:

Begin by researching the motorcycle’s make and model to understand its features, specifications, and any common issues.

Check NADA Value:

Use NADA Motorcycle Value to determine the estimated fair market value of the motorcycle you’re interested in. This value serves as a benchmark for assessing the asking price.

Inspect the Motorcycle:

Physically inspect the motorcycle or have a trusted mechanic perform a thorough inspection to assess its condition. Any discrepancies should be factored into your negotiations.

 

Negotiate Based on NADA Value:

Use the NADA value as a reference point during negotiations. It helps you ensure that you’re getting a fair deal and that the asking price aligns with the motorcycle’s value.

Selling a Used Motorcycle:

If you’re selling a used motorcycle, consider these tips for a successful transaction:

Determine the NADA Value:

Calculate the NADA Motorcycle Value for your motorcycle. This value provides a starting point for setting a competitive asking price.

Showcase Your Motorcycle:

Present your motorcycle in the best possible condition. Ensure it’s clean, well-maintained, and any required maintenance or repairs are up to date.

Provide Documentation:

Gather all relevant documentation, including maintenance records, service history, and the motorcycle’s title. Having a complete record enhances its value and trustworthiness.

High-Quality Photos:

Take clear and detailed photos of your motorcycle from various angles. Quality visuals attract potential buyers and provide a comprehensive view of the motorcycle’s condition.

Transparent Listing:

Be transparent about your motorcycle’s history, including any accidents, modifications, or upgrades. Honesty builds trust with potential buyers.

Price Competitively:

Set your asking price based on the NADA Motorcycle Value and market conditions. A competitive price increases the likelihood of attracting potential buyers.
